My most bizarre norn death remains the norn that died for apparantly no reason. I'm pretty sure I told this story already, but the forum might have eaten my post, so....
A few years back, my first set of twins hatched in C3. They were (apparantly) identical males, generation 2, pretty standard overall. I saved them as babies and imported them into a docked DS world.
Well, it turned out that twin 1 was a huge, kleptomatic, rat fink ba... em, he was not nice, so I separated the two and used him as a sort of torture test subject. '>_> I tested the limits of his lung capacty (well, how else was I supposed see if the bottom layer of Bug's Temple actually had water in it?) and dropped him outside the ark to see if that hidden room actually existed, and I even bounced him around the workshop a few times.
Nothing killed this stupid thing.
So, I finally gave up and decided he'd had enough. I took him to the medical bay to check his stats, and as soon as he approaches the pod, he collapses and dies.
No bacteria. No hunger. No old age (he'd just hit adulthood). No complaints of discomfort. He just... collapsed. I cold-crashed the game and restarted it to see if I could save him, or figure out why he'd died. Maybe if I got some food into him or something....
Nope. I showered him with food, and he ate it, and then he collapsed again.
Now, maybe his injuries were catching up to him, or maybe he had some genetic defect that his brother (who lived for a good 5 or 6 hours) had somehow avoided, but between you and me... I think my game was sick of him and autokilled his brain or something. :P The medical bay and HoloDoc weren't telling me anything interesting, at any rate, and though it's entirely possible that I just MISSED something, I simply couldn't find any reason for him to just up and croak it the way he did.
He's still got a clone on my hard drive somewhere. I'm tempted to drag his genome out and see if I just missed something obvious--Officer 1BDI

In my first few experiments with the brain genes, I decided to see the effects of deleting different lobes. But the results were not too horribly interesting. So I went and randomly altered bits of the brain, deleted some parts (I use Genetics Lab, which gives a nice big editable representation of the brain), and added other lobes.
The result was a norn that just kinda sat there and made the other norns stupid by telling them the wrong things (I played with his instincts, too). If a norn would say it was hungry, he would tell it to go to the left, or if it said it was lonely it would tell it to eat seeds. And he never seemed to age after adult.
And for some strange reason his sprites were all messed up; he retained the baby plant norn stub arms all through his life. But they were were his legs should have been. Needless to say, he was unable to walk, so I had to constantly set food by him.
Afterwards I just edited him to not need anything, and just get everything he needed from breathing. So after putting the improved version of Sqootl as I called him in a world all his own, he fell silent.
Naturally I fired up the mini-copier and made a dozen of the things, and they all started babbling incoherently to each other, with conversations usually boiled down to the original saying it liked a random member of his audience, and the entire audience shouting en masse that they loved him.
I had so much fun with these guys that I got out the physics adapter and adjusted them to the point where they could bounce around infinitely when thrown. I made a ton of the little guys, threw around, and watched 'em bounce. But I needed more.
So one day I flooded the entire meso (all three levels) with Sqootls. They were all bouncing around at high speed, and when I checked the population count, it read 572! I couldn't even see the background or any agents, it was all just a giant Sqootl storm.
Then they all died. At once. They all just fell from the sky like flies. I almost died laughing--Geohevy

I had a never-ager adolescence zebra male. I was kinda bored, and didn't know what to do with him. I took him to the grendle jungle, and figured I'd try to poison him.. See if he was truely immortal. Now, I don't know if there's just nothing poisonous in there, but he ate mushrooms, various seeds, a dragonfly.. and possibly tried to eat some things that were too big for him. Decided to do that all on his own, but didn't even get sick! So I got him eating the "pests". It only took a little encouragement, and then he pretty much did it on his own.. eating wasps and mosquitos. Still not sick. So I tell him to push the pests. Gets a small swarm of wasps stinging him.. and his pain goes up to two blocks below full, but doesn't get sick, runs away, and heals up quickly. So I grab some stingers from the meso. Still no effect. I try to get him to push a swarm of wasps again, still nothing. So I wait until his pain is fully healed, and try smacking him around a little, to see if it's even possible to get his pain up to full. Well, before his pain levels are even halfway where they were with the wasps, he drops dead. Still not sick.. All other levels are fine, though he was a little scared...
I just found it weird that eating everything from questionable fruits and seeds, to bugs, and pests, and then getting him to get himself attacked my wasps, stingers and mosquitos had NO results, and then I slap him a little, and he drops dead, when he isn't even in as much pain as when he had a whole swarm of wasps on him, heh.--CrystalKitten
